Leon’s Weapons in Resident Evil 2
- Matilda - The starting pistol for Leon Kennedy that fires standard 9mm bullets. If anyone knows why Leon named his pistol, please let us know in the comments below, because it’s a source of confusion for us.
- Shotgun - Thankfully this weapon isn’t named, but it’s available to be unlocked from the weapons locked within the Raccoon City police station.
- Magnum - Now this weapon packs a punch. It’s a long road for Leon to unlock the magnum, but it can take out any standard zombie with a single shot.
- Flamethrower - You won’t be able to unlock this weapon for Leon until you’ve made it through the sewers area, but it’s essential for dealing with some late-game zombie types.

Claire’s Weapons in Resident Evil 2
- Revolver - Claire hasn’t named her starting weapon in Resident Evil 2 because she’s not weird.
- Grenade launcher - Whereas Leon gets the shotgun in the police department weapons locker, Claire instead unlocks the grenade launcher.
- SMG - This weapon can be unlocked for Claire in the STARS office in the police station, but like the magnum, it’s a long process to unlock the weapon.
- Spark shot - In what might be the most unique weapon in Resident Evil 2, Claire can charge up shots with this experimental weapon, unleashing bolts of energy at zombies.
Best Weapons in Resident Evil 2
Now that we’ve given you a walkthrough of all the available weapons in Resident Evil 2, which ones are the best? For Leon, there’s absolutely no contest, as the magnum is the undisputed king of firepower in the entire game. As we said above, it’ll kill a zombie in a single hit, and even on the harder difficulties it can take out creatures like the sludge monsters in the sewer pretty quickly.

As for Claire, we’d honestly have to go with the grenade launcher. Ammo for Claire’s grenade launcher isn’t actually overly rare, like it sort of is for Leon’s shotgun. Acid rounds are excellent for stopping a group of zombies in their tracks, and the fire rounds can take out strong monsters like the Lickers in as few as two hits.

To the surprise of presumably no one, Capcom has in fact confirmed that it’s planning another Resident Evil remake - but it hasn’t said which game’s getting one.
It’s no secret that Capcom’s Resident Evil remakes have been doing exceptionally well - Resident Evil 4 Remake sold three million copies within its first two days . So hearing that Capcom is working on more was pretty much a given. Resident Evil 4 Remake director Yasuhiro Anpo was the one to confirm more remakes are on the way, quite simply replying “Yes,” when asked by IGN if the developer had plans for more. “We’ve released three remakes so far and they have all been received very well. Since it allows a modern audience to play these games, it is something I am happy to do as someone that loves these older games, and we want to continue doing more.
“What game we will remake in the future is something that we would like to announce in the future, so please look forward to it.” There hasn’t been any kind of hints so far as to which games Capcom might remake, though it has been trying to figure out which games you want to see remade . Code Veronica seemingly isn’t off the table , but of course there are games like the original Resident Evil or Resident Evil 0. Plus, there’s the more actiony Resident Evil 5, which is the next one numerically, though that one obviously marked quite a shift for the survival horror series.
